The Day That Changed The Way I Think About Healing...

I remember the exact day my thoughts about conventional healing shifted. I was the charge nurse on a hospital oncology unit. One day, while working on my unit and preparing to infuse another IV, I held a bag of chemotherapy tightly in my right hand. As I reached for the IV tubing with my free hand, I spotted a medical magazine on the counter nearby. On the cover, in bold print, it read, “Energy Healing has been shown to reduce the size of tumors in a recent study.” It immediately awoke my interest. What was this “Energy Healing” about and if, indeed, it reduced tumors, could we practice it in my department?
After I read the journal, I was so drawn to the research and extraordinary stories of reducing the size of tumors with the use of healing hands therapy that I wanted to learn more.
I searched for places to study this type of intervention and a month later enrolled in a class called “Therapeutic Touch” at Michigan State University. That was the beginning of a long journey of discovery into the world of healing mind, body, and spirit. A powerful and new dimension of healing was revealed to me, one I never knew existed.
